Address

fact1qhlatpcy0v64eugwzy7sjlz43u38vzahyutp5zy

0 FACT

Confirmed
Total Received0.38899259 FACT
Total Sent0.38899259 FACT
Final Balance0 FACT
No. Transactions2

Transactions